Knoi and VXT are both AI meeting assistants for recording, transcription, and summaries, compared here on pricing, features, and workflow fit. Knoi: AI meeting assistant that records, transcribes, summarizes, and translates meetings, with team organization and Q&A. VXT: Communications platform for law firms with an AI notetaker (VXT Meet) for recording and summarizing meetings. They overlap on ai-meeting-assistants, so the right pick depends on team size, budget, and which meeting workflows you automate.
For ai-meeting-assistants workflows, shortlist Knoi when documenting and summarizing team meetings automatically matters most, and VXT when attorneys capturing client consultations without manual notes matters most. Both record across Zoom, Google Meet, and Microsoft Teams; trial each on real meetings before committing.

Pros & cons
Knoi
+ Strong support for Korean-English multilingual meetings
+ Automatically organizes and makes past meetings searchable
- Translation is limited to a small set of languages
VXT
+ Built specifically for law firms and legal workflows
+ Connects meeting notes to practice management systems
- Designed for legal professionals, not general business users
